Summary
The United States District Court for the Northern District of Indiana grants Plaintiff’s motion to compel discovery and grants Defendant’s motion to stay civil proceedings in part. The court declines to find Defendant’s one-day-late discovery objection waived but grants the motion to compel because Defendant did not oppose it or meet his burden to justify withholding the requested materials. The court stays all proceedings except production of responsive documents and requires a status report regarding the related criminal case.
Holdings
- Defendant's one-day delay in serving his objection did not warrant total waiver because the delay resulted from counsel's mistake, caused minimal prejudice, and constituted good cause for relief from waiver.
- Plaintiff was entitled to an order compelling Defendant to produce documents responsive to her second request for production.
- A partial stay was appropriate because the civil and criminal proceedings arose from the same facts and civil discovery could burden Defendant's Fifth Amendment rights, but the stay did not apply to Plaintiff's motion to compel.
Questions Presented
- Whether Defendant's one-day delay in asserting an objection to Plaintiff's second request for production waived the objection.
- Whether Plaintiff was entitled to an order compelling production when Defendant did not respond to the motion to compel or carry his burden of showing why the requested discovery was improper.
- Whether the civil action should be stayed because of the related criminal prosecution and the potential effect of civil discovery on Defendant's Fifth Amendment rights.
